  • Clothing Day

    On 31 May 2011 Feast of Our Lady’s Visitation to Elizabeth, after a year’s postulancy, Maria Kwan received the Habit of Carmel, taking the name Sister Maria of the Resurrection. She now begins her Novitiate

Quote of the week: "When the soul is brought into the seventh dwelling place, the Most Blessed Trinity, all three Persons, through an intellectual vision, is revealed to it through a certain representation of the truth. First there comes an enkindling in the spirit in the manner of a cloud of magnificent splendour, and through an admirable knowledge the soul understands as a most profound truth that all three Persons are one substance and one power and one knowledge and one God alone. It knows in such a way that what we hold by faith, it understands we can say, through sight...Here all three Persons communicate themselves to it, and explain those words of the Lord in the Gospel, that He and the Father and the Holy Spirit will come to dwell with the soul that loves Him and keeps His commandments". Interior Castle V11. 1:6
